The purpose of this workshop is to create a space for you to reflect on the skills you are developing through your Study Abroad experience, in an academic context. Through sample experiences, both academic and social, you will have the opportunity to extract skills and gain an understanding of how these abilities enhance your resume. We will introduce the concept of Global Literacy and cover skills such as active listening, inferring and using evidence, data presentation, speaking and debating - all skills that will set you apart in an increasingly competetive global jobs market.
